Creating the proxy partition on a GV STRATUS Express server
The recommended method is to restore the Express Server using the system specific image that shipped on the server. When you do so, the proxy partition is also restored. However, if for some reason you must create the proxy partition manually, use this procedure.
- Log into the server as Administrator.
- On the Windows desktop, next to the Start menu, click on the Server Manager Icon. Server Manager opens.
- In the Server Manager tree select Storage | Disk Management.
- Right-click on CD-ROM 0 and select Change Drive Letter and Paths.
- Select the F: drive letter and click the Change button.
- In the Assign the following drive letter drop-down list select G.
- Click OK.
- Click Yes.
- Right-click on Disk 0's Unallocated disk space and select New Simple Volume. The New Simple Volume wizard opens.
- On the wizard's first page, click Next.
- On the Specify Volume Size page, select the maximum size (should be the default) and click Next.
- On the Assign Drive Letter page, select F and click Next.
-
On the Format Partition page, select
Format this Volume with the following Settings
and make settings as follows:
Option Setting File System NTFS Allocation Unit Size Default Volume Label Proxy Check Perform a quick format Note: Do not check "Enable file and folder compression" - Click Next.
- Click Finish. The wizard closes.
- Verify that the partition has been created.
